Question: A 1.83 kg book is placed on a flat desk. Suppose the coefficient of static friction between the book and the desk is 0.502 and the coefficient of kinetic friction is 0.273.

Part A: How much force is needed to begin moving the book?

____N

Part B: How much force is needed to keep the book moving at constant speed once it begins moving?

____N
